Transaction 47c682252c988607158f97a949fde63377c4be75c43424fdf2827cbf35faa8b0
3 Input
2 Outputs
- 47c682252c988607158f97a949fde63377c4be75c43424fdf2827cbf35faa8b0:0
- 47c682252c988607158f97a949fde63377c4be75c43424fdf2827cbf35faa8b0:1
value 800010
address 1BhAeiU1zmCeM6R37KphA1ez2dpttu6fcn
value 102487956
address 35kZVmCcRJ2Kk2haqU3F64kGrM7y1fiK7U